Working with Pivotal Labs Danny Burkes Director, Pivotal Labs Tokyo
[email protected]
Our mission is to transform how the world builds software
Helping great companies become great software companies
How do we do this? We teach your team by
creating together
We build together We learn together We teach each other
We improve together
Step 1 - Build a small team Six to ten
people, mixed staffing Developers, Product Designers, Product Managers Work face-to-face every day Deliver production-ready software every day
Step 2 - Build a backlog Always focus on the
users, not the technology Build what the users want Talk to the users, continuously Break the work into small, discrete chunks of value
Step 3 - Pair everywhere Pair your developers with ours
Pair your product designers with ours Pair your product manager with ours Learn every minute, as a part of every activity
Step 4 - Deliver value continuously Always be shipping (or
at least shippable) Gather user feedback regularly Adjust your priorities and direction as needed Find product/market fit faster and at a lower cost
Discover Prioritize Implement Release Gather Feedback Repeat
Cycle times in days, not months Build less Lower risk
Trust your users Trust your team
What does success mean? A product that your users love
A team that can continue iterating Cultural value plus business value Trained staff that can lead your transformation effort
